Unlike standard electricians who focus on internal electrical wiring and fit-outs, Level 2 Electricians possess a specialized accreditation, referred to as an Accredited Provider (ASP) Level 2 accreditation, which allows them to work straight on the service lines connecting homes to the main power grid. This knowledge makes them important to homeowners and organizations in Blacktown, New South Wales, for complex and high-voltage electrical serves as a vital secure, guaranteeing that power systems operate effectively and comply with strict state and distributor security policies.
The primary difference of a Blacktown Level 2 Electrician is their authorisation to perform what is thought about 'contestable work,' which involves the electrical facilities from the street up to the client's meter panel. This scope is meticulously defined by various service classifications, each requiring specific training and accreditation. First of all, disconnection and reconnection is one of their core services. If significant structural work, remodellings, or demolitions are taking place, the residential or commercial property must be securely isolated from the main supply. Just a Level 2 Electrician can officially sever and later restore the power connection, collaborating straight with the network operator, such as Endeavour Energy or Ausgrid, whose networks run in the Blacktown area. This procedure guarantees the security of all parties and the stability of the electrical energy supply network.
Second Of All, Blacktown Level 2 Electricians specialise in the installation, repair, and upkeep of overhead and underground service lines. The customer mains, whether running above or below ground, are the vital cables providing power to the home. They are the only experts licensed to work on these lines, whether it includes fixing storm damage, relocating the point of accessory for overhead lines throughout a renovation, or totally upgrading old customer mains to handle increased power loads. They manage everything from the personal power pole or the street pillar right to the main switchboard. A third, similarly essential function is electrical power metering services. As technology evolves, numerous properties in Blacktown need meter upgrades, such as converting older single-phase connections to modern-day three-phase power to support high-demand equipment like ducted air conditioning or electric automobile (EV) battery chargers. Furthermore, they are responsible for setting up and replacing new smart meters and managing off-peak or solar net-metering setups. This work is necessary for accurate billing and effective energy management, and it can just be licensed by a Blacktown Level 2 Electrician.
The intricacy of electrical infrastructure indicates that energy suppliers regularly release Problem Notifications to homeowner where a fault or safety threat has been determined on the service-side wiring. These notifications are severe and legally binding, mandating prompt correction to make sure public and property safety. A Blacktown Level 2 Electrician is the mandated expert to deal with and license the repair work of these problems, which frequently include problems like damaged service fuses, exposed customer mains, or non-compliant switchboard parts near the service point. Beyond arranged work, Blacktown Level 2 Electricians are often the very first port of call for electrical emergencies that affect the primary power supply. This could consist of damage caused by extreme weather condition-- a typical incident in parts of New South Wales-- such as fallen power lines, damage to personal power poles, or faults that result in a total loss of power to the home. Their authorisation permits them to respond quickly, identify the issue at the network limit, and carry out high-risk repairs securely and legally, typically supplying a vital 24/7 service to the regional neighborhood.
To achieve the status of a Blacktown Level 2 Electrician, an individual Blacktown ASP Level 2 Electricians must first be a fully qualified electrician and then complete specialised, state-specific training to become an Accredited Company. This extensive procedure includes demonstrating proficiency in working on the distribution network, adhering to strict safety procedures, and comprehending the specific requirements of local network operators. This high level of accreditation guarantees that every job, from an easy meter modification to a complex underground cable installation, is performed with accuracy, security, and complete compliance with governing body guidelines and Australian standards.
